Job Summary:

The Occupational Therapist assesses, plans, organizes and participates in rehabilitative programs that help to restore or improve function in activities of daily living, functional mobility, cognitive tasks, strength, coordination and range of motion in patients suffering from disease or injury. Services are provided across the full continuum and rendered in a cost conscious, quality focused and customer oriented manner. Compliance with all applicable regulatory standards is also required in this role.

Core Responsibilities and Essential Functions:

Treatment Planning and Provision of Care

Implements the occupational therapy treatment plan

Selects appropriate treatment activities to progress patient towards goals.

Revises goals/plan of care with patient/family input

Provides ongoing patient/family education and training

Provides discharge instructions, follow-up and referral to community resources as appropriate

Acts as a referral source for staff, families, physicians on services and equipment related to rehabilitation services.

Patient Assessment

In collaboration with the physician, responsible for the establishment and ongoing evaluation of treatment programs, plan of care, goals and discharge plans for the patients as related to the occupational therapy needs of the patient.

Establishes a plan of care in conjunction with the patient and/or family members.

Establishes realistic discharge plan incorporating patient and/or family member goals.

Documentation

Documents the evaluation and plan of care according to departmental guidelines

Documents each treatment session according to departmental protocols

Completes and submits family education, discharge and other required documentation within facility and program guidelines.
